1. A Blend of Climates: Continental Meets Mediterranean
Ljubljana’s location in central Slovenia places it right at the crossroads of two major climate zones. The city experiences a mix of continental and Mediterranean climates, making it a unique weather wonderland. During summer, the heat can rival any Mediterranean hotspot, while winter brings cold snaps typical of continental Europe. This duality means Ljubljana can feel like a different city depending on the season. 🌞❄️
The continental influence brings colder winters with occasional snowfall, perfect for those who dream of white Christmases. Meanwhile, the Mediterranean touch ensures warm summers with plenty of sunshine, ideal for strolling through the picturesque old town. This combination creates a climate that’s both refreshing and inviting throughout the year. 🏖️🏔️

3. Seasonal Highlights: When to Visit for Optimal Weather
Planning a trip to Ljubljana? Understanding the seasonal weather can help you pick the perfect time to visit. Summer (June-August) is peak tourist season, with temperatures averaging around 70°F (21°C), making it ideal for outdoor adventures. However, be prepared for crowds and higher prices. 🌞💰
For a more relaxed experience, consider visiting during spring (April-May) or early autumn (September-October). These periods offer pleasant temperatures and fewer tourists, allowing you to enjoy Ljubljana’s charms without the hustle and bustle. Winter (December-February) can be chilly, with occasional snow, but it’s also a magical time to see the city decked out in holiday lights. ❄️✨
